中文翻译
“拍手,一只手拍另一只手,”那个自负的男人现在指示他。
小王子拍了拍他的双手。
那个自负的男人谦逊地举帽致意。
“这比拜访国王更有趣,”小王子自言自语道。
然后他又开始拍手,一只手拍另一只手。
那个自负的男人再次举帽致意。
经过五分钟这样的练习,小王子对这种游戏的单调性感到厌倦了。
“那要怎么做才能让帽子掉下来呢?”他问道。
但是那个自负的人没有听见他的话。
自负的人除了赞美什么都听不进去。

重点语法
5 个1
one against the other
固定搭配,表示“相互,一个对另一个”
原文
Clap your hands, one against the other.
拍手,一个对着另一个。
例句
He rubbed his hands, one against the other.
他搓着双手。
2
grow tired of
固定搭配,表示“变得厌倦...”
原文
the little prince grew tired of the game's monotony.
小王子开始厌倦这个游戏的单调。
例句
She grew tired of waiting and left.
她等得不耐烦就走了。
3
more...than...
比较级结构,表示“比...更...”
原文
This is more entertaining than the visit to the king.
这比拜访国王更有趣。
例句
Running is more tiring than walking.
跑步比走路更累。
4
never...anything but...
双重否定结构,表示“只...,除了...什么都不...”
原文
Conceited people never hear anything but praise.
自负的人除了赞美什么都听不见。
例句
He never eats anything but vegetables.
他只吃蔬菜。
5
said to himself
固定搭配,表示“自言自语,心里想”
原文
the little prince said to himself.
小王子自言自语道。
例句
"I can do it," he said to himself.
"我能做到,"他心想。
